[docs] class SisenseDatamodelTable(Sisense): """Description""" type_name: str = Field(default="SisenseDatamodelTable", allow_mutation=False) @validator("type_name") def validate_type_name(cls, v): if v != "SisenseDatamodelTable": raise ValueError("must be SisenseDatamodelTable") return v def __setattr__(self, name, value): if name in SisenseDatamodelTable._convenience_properties: return object.__setattr__(self, name, value) super().__setattr__(name, value) SISENSE_DATAMODEL_QUALIFIED_NAME: ClassVar[KeywordTextField] = KeywordTextField( "sisenseDatamodelQualifiedName", "sisenseDatamodelQualifiedName", "sisenseDatamodelQualifiedName.text", ) """ Unique name of the datamodel in which this datamodel table exists. """ SISENSE_DATAMODEL_TABLE_COLUMN_COUNT: ClassVar[NumericField] = NumericField( "sisenseDatamodelTableColumnCount", "sisenseDatamodelTableColumnCount" ) """ Number of columns present in this datamodel table. """ SISENSE_DATAMODEL_TABLE_TYPE: ClassVar[KeywordField] = KeywordField( "sisenseDatamodelTableType", "sisenseDatamodelTableType" ) """ Type of this datamodel table, for example: 'base' for regular tables, 'custom' for SQL expression-based tables. """ SISENSE_DATAMODEL_TABLE_EXPRESSION: ClassVar[TextField] = TextField( "sisenseDatamodelTableExpression", "sisenseDatamodelTableExpression" ) """ SQL expression of this datamodel table. """ SISENSE_DATAMODEL_TABLE_IS_MATERIALIZED: ClassVar[BooleanField] = BooleanField( "sisenseDatamodelTableIsMaterialized", "sisenseDatamodelTableIsMaterialized" ) """ Whether this datamodel table is materialised (true) or not (false). """ SISENSE_DATAMODEL_TABLE_IS_HIDDEN: ClassVar[BooleanField] = BooleanField( "sisenseDatamodelTableIsHidden", "sisenseDatamodelTableIsHidden" ) """ Whether this datamodel table is hidden in Sisense (true) or not (false). """ SISENSE_DATAMODEL_TABLE_SCHEDULE: ClassVar[KeywordField] = KeywordField( "sisenseDatamodelTableSchedule", "sisenseDatamodelTableSchedule" ) """ JSON specifying the refresh schedule of this datamodel table. """ SISENSE_DATAMODEL_TABLE_LIVE_QUERY_SETTINGS: ClassVar[KeywordField] = KeywordField( "sisenseDatamodelTableLiveQuerySettings", "sisenseDatamodelTableLiveQuerySettings", ) """ JSON specifying the LiveQuery settings of this datamodel table. """ SISENSE_WIDGETS: ClassVar[RelationField] = RelationField("sisenseWidgets") """ TBC """ SISENSE_DATAMODEL: ClassVar[RelationField] = RelationField("sisenseDatamodel") """ TBC """
